The Mechanics of Mayhem: Mastering the Art of the Crossing
The fundamental gameplay of this digital dash for survival revolves around precise timing and anticipation. Players control the chicken, typically using tap or swipe gestures, to move it forward across multiple lanes of oncoming traffic. Each lane presents a unique set of challenges. Early on, the vehicles move at a manageable pace, allowing players to learn the rhythm of the road. However, as the chicken successfully navigates each lane, the speed of the cars increases, and more vehicles begin to appear, creating a frenetic and demanding scenario. Successful plays depend on identifying gaps in the traffic and swiftly exploiting them before they close. Strategic foresight is vital, as relying solely on reaction time will inevitably lead to a feathered failure.
Beyond the core concept of avoiding collisions, subtle nuances can significantly impact a player’s performance. Some versions of the game introduce power-ups, offering temporary invincibility or speed boosts, adding another layer of complexity. Mastering these power-ups and utilizing them at critical moments can be the difference between a successful run and a swift demise. Understanding the patterns of the vehicles is also crucial. While the game presents a seemingly random traffic flow, observant players will begin to notice certain tendencies and anticipate the movements of approaching cars. This element of pattern recognition elevates the game beyond simple reflex-based action and introduces a strategic element that rewards attentive players.

Advanced Strategies for Chicken Crossing Mastery
Beyond the basic principle of dodging traffic, achieving consistently high scores requires advanced strategies and refined techniques. One crucial strategy is to anticipate the movement of vehicles based on their speed and distance. Rather than reacting to instantly approaching cars, experienced players begin planning their moves several seconds in advance, identifying potential gaps and preparing to exploit them. This proactive approach reduces the pressure of split-second decisions and minimizes the risk of errors. Another effective technique is to utilize the edges of the lanes, creating a slightly larger margin for error when maneuvering between cars.
Understanding the underlying patterns of the game’s traffic generation algorithm can also provide a significant advantage. While the traffic appears random, it is often governed by predictable parameters. By observing the game over time, players can identify these patterns and use them to their benefit, anticipating the timing of traffic surges and planning their crossings accordingly. Mastering these advanced techniques separates the casual players from the dedicated enthusiasts, transforming the chicken road game from a simple time-waster into a challenging and rewarding skill-based experience.
